The median value of a house in the city is $101,100, which is much lower than the US median value of $338,100. Additionally, furthering its appeal to potential buyers and investors alike, housing in Hayward has seen an appreciation rate of 13.45% over the past year compared to the US rate of 8.27%. The median home cost in Hayward is $101,100.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 73.2%. Home Appreciation in Hayward is up 17.1%.
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Hayward real estate is 35 years old
The Rental Market in Hayward
- Renters make up 35.1% of the Hayward population
- 0.0% of houses and apartments in Hayward, are available to rent
